SailPoint Developer

Saxon Global
6 days ago

Role details

Contract type
Permanent contract
Employment type
Full-time (> 32 hours)
Working hours
Regular working hours
Languages
English
Experience level
Senior

Job location

Remote

Tech stack

Java
Microsoft Excel
Microsoft Active Directory
API
Cloud Computing
Data Synchronization
Java Platform Enterprise Edition (J2EE)
Identity and Access Management
JavaBeans
Kerberos (Protocol)
Lightweight Directory Access Protocols (LDAP)
Object-Oriented Software Development
Role-Based Access Control
Power BI
Systems Integration
Software Vulnerability Management
Enterprise Software Applications
Enterprise Integration
SailPoint
BeanShell

Job description

Skilled professional responsible for designing, developing, and implementing enterprise Identity and Access Management (IAM) solutions using SailPoint IdentityIQ (IIQ). This role requires strong hands-on development experience, deep understanding of identity lifecycle automation, and the ability to optimize and govern IAM platforms at scale. The SailPoint Developer collaborates with cross-functional teams to translate business requirements into secure, high-performing IAM solutions that enhance access governance, security posture, and regulatory compliance., Identity Governance & Development

  • Design and develop custom IAM functionalities using Java (J2EE/Java Beans) to support end-to-end identity lifecycle management, including provisioning, de-provisioning, access requests, certifications, and access reconciliation.
  • Implement and customize SailPoint IIQ objects, APIs, workflows, rules (BeanShell), and connectors to meet complex business and compliance requirements.
  • Tune and optimize SailPoint provisioning performance by improving BeanShell rule execution, connector response handling, and system workflows.

Integration & API Development

  • Develop and maintain custom integrations with enterprise applications, directories, and platforms using SailPoint APIs and connector frameworks.
  • Ensure secure and reliable data synchronization across identity sources, target systems, and authoritative systems.

Privileged Access Management (PAM)

  • Maintain PAM infrastructure, including component server health, patching, and vulnerability remediation in alignment with security standards.
  • Automate and support PAM operational activities, including incident tickets, outages, emergency access processes, and DR/BCP drills.

Security, Compliance & Governance

  • Ensure IAM solutions comply with internal security policies and external regulatory standards.
  • Implement and enforce RBAC, access control policies, and governance controls to protect sensitive systems and data.
  • Maintain key access governance metrics and KPIs, providing leadership visibility into IAM health, risk, and compliance posture.

Reporting & Documentation

  • Develop dashboards and reports using Excel and Power BI to track governance metrics, operational performance, and compliance readiness.
  • Produce comprehensive technical documentation, including solution designs, configurations, integrations, and operational runbooks.

Collaboration & Leadership

  • Collaborate with IT, Security, Compliance, and Application Owners to align IAM solutions with organizational standards.
  • Lead technical design discussions, mentor junior engineers, and support project managers to ensure successful and timely IAM delivery.

Requirements

  • Possession of Security+ or equivalent.
  • At least 10 years of experience designing and implementing IAM solutions.
  • At least 4 years of experience implementing enterprise identity governance & administration (IGA) solutions, such as:
  • SailPoint Identity IQ (IIQ) or IdentityNow
  • Saviynt Security Manager (SSM) or Enterprise Identity Cloud (EIC)
  • IBM Security Verify Governance
  • SailPoint Expertise:
  • Strong hands-on experience with SailPoint IIQ, including lifecycle workflows, certifications, policies, connectors, and APIs.
  • In-depth understanding of SailPoint object model and extensibility framework.
  • Java Development:
  • Fluent in Java (J2EE / Java Beans) with practical experience building custom rules, workflows, and integrations.
  • IAM / ICAM Architecture:
  • Proven ability to design and implement enterprise Identity Credential & Access Management (ICAM) solutions.
  • Active Directory & Infrastructure:
  • Deep expertise in Active Directory, LDAP/Kerberos, and application authentication integrations.
  • Operational Excellence:
  • Advanced troubleshooting skills across IAM, PAM, and integrated platforms.
  • Experience supporting production environments, outages, emergency access, and DR exercises.
  • Stakeholder & Leadership Skills:
  • Ability to translate complex technical solutions into clear business outcomes for stakeholders.

Nice to Have

  • Saviyant
  • Identity Cloud
  • IBM Security Verify Governance

Apply for this position